.header[data-v-25d6af53]{width:100%}.nav-bar[data-v-25d6af53]{text-align:right;padding:20px;line-height:3em}a[data-v-25d6af53]{text-transform:uppercase;margin-left:15px;margin-right:15px;padding-bottom:8px;white-space:nowrap;display:inline-block;color:#dcdcdc;opacity:.5}.router-link-exact-active[data-v-25d6af53]{border:0 solid #dcdcdc;border-bottom-width:2px;opacity:1}@media only screen and (max-width:620px){.nav-bar[data-v-25d6af53]{line-height:2em}a[data-v-25d6af53]{margin-left:9px;margin-right:9px;padding-bottom:0}}.footer[data-v-cfd6f896]{background-color:#383838;width:100%;font-size:.8em;opacity:.7;padding-bottom:30px}.left[data-v-cfd6f896],.right[data-v-cfd6f896]{padding-top:10px;text-align:center}@media only screen and (min-width:620px){.footer[data-v-cfd6f896]{padding:0}.left[data-v-cfd6f896],.right[data-v-cfd6f896]{padding:20px}.left[data-v-cfd6f896]{float:left}.right[data-v-cfd6f896]{float:right}}.dialog-content .paragraph{margin:20px 0}.dialog-content .center{text-align:center}.dialog-content iframe.youtube{width:100%;min-height:300px}.dialog-content .horizontal-screenshot,.dialog-content .vertical-screenshot{width:100%}.dialog-content .notice{border:1px solid #d8000c;border-radius:12px;background-color:#ffbaba;color:#d8000c;padding:10px;text-align:center}.dialog-content a{text-decoration:underline}.dialog-content a img{transition:all .2s}.dialog-content a img:hover{transform:scale(1.1)}.dialog-content .project-card{background-color:hsla(0,0%,100%,.33);padding:20px;border-radius:10px;box-shadow:0 4px 8px rgba(0,0,0,.1)}.dialog-content .info-grid{display:flex;justify-content:space-between}.dialog-content .info-column{width:calc(50% - 25px);display:flex;flex-direction:column;gap:10px}.dialog-content .info-item{display:flex;justify-content:space-between;border-bottom:1px solid #e0e0e0;padding-bottom:5px}.dialog-content .info-tags{text-align:center;padding-top:20px;font-style:italic}.dialog-content .label{font-weight:700;white-space:nowrap}.dialog-content .value{text-align:right}.dialog-content .project-links{display:flex;justify-content:center;gap:50px;flex-wrap:wrap}.dialog-content .project-links a{display:inline-block}@media only screen and (min-width:620px){.dialog-content iframe.youtube{max-width:728px;height:409px}.dialog-content .horizontal-screenshot{margin:10px;width:435px}.dialog-content .vertical-screenshot{margin:10px;width:280px}}@media only screen and (max-width:920px){.dialog-content .info-grid{flex-direction:column;gap:10px}.dialog-content .info-column{width:100%}.dialog-content .info-item{justify-content:space-between;gap:10px}.dialog-content .project-links{gap:30px}}@media (max-width:620px){.dialog-content .project-links{flex-direction:column;gap:3px}}body,html{margin:0;background-color:#383838}#app{background-color:#434348;color:#dcdcdc;font-family:Karla,Helvetica,Arial,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-size:1.1em;line-height:1.6em}#app,h1,h2,h3,h4,h5{text-align:left}a{color:#1aaedb;text-decoration:none}.router-link-exact-active,a:hover{color:#1eceff}h1{font-size:2.5em;font-weight:100;margin-top:-10px;margin-bottom:40px;margin-left:-2px;line-height:1.1em}.main{padding:12px}@media only screen and (max-width:620px){html{font-size:75%}ul{padding-left:20px}}@media only screen and (min-width:620px){#app{text-align:left;line-height:1.8em}h1{margin-top:.67em;margin-bottom:60px;line-height:.7em}.main{padding:0 40px 40px 180px}.footer,.header,.main{max-width:1200px;margin:0 auto}}.fade-enter-active,.fade-leave-active{transition-duration:.2s;transition-property:opacity;transition-timing-function:ease}.fade-enter,.fade-leave-active{opacity:0}